SKANSKA is looking for a Multi Skilled Engineer to join our team in Worral House, Kent. The ideal candidate will efficiently handle maintenance and emergency repairs of Electrical and Mechanical services, ensuring high standards of workmanship.
The role requires strong customer care and communication skills, with qualifications including NVQ level 3 in electrical engineering and familiarity with wiring regulations.
SKANSKA offers flexible working and comprehensive employee benefits.
